Transaction 51d75d26a34168528e2070c84db6497c6520143509cbd1d3b7a28f38c0c1fa35

2 Input
2 Outputs
  • 51d75d26a34168528e2070c84db6497c6520143509cbd1d3b7a28f38c0c1fa35:0
  • value  4720670
    address  bc1qlxwd49jlugzstg4fh7uejwevdqpwfvgrrn8z56
  • 51d75d26a34168528e2070c84db6497c6520143509cbd1d3b7a28f38c0c1fa35:1
  • value  3808881
    address  39Co7BMppdNUhxDfMMr7Jz5YmfbTGQi7VY